Hallo!
Ich erstelle gerade ein Bestellformular. Nachdem man eine Bestellung abgeschickt hat, bekommt man eine automatisch erstellte Email als Bestätigung der Bestellung. Diese Bestätigung ist bei mir als txt.-Datei abgespeichert. Das Problem ist, dass diese automatisch erstelle Nachricht kein äöü und ß anzeigt, weshalb die Daten, die der Nutzer in das Bestellformular eingegeben hat, komisch aussehen, wenn der Name z.B. ein ü enthält.
Was muss ich verändern, damit das geht?
Vielleicht in dieser Zeile?
$v_email = preg_replace( "/[^a-z0-9 !?:;,./_-=+@#$&\*()]/im", "", $v_email );
oder hier?
function check_email($email)
{
return (eregi('[1]([-_.]?[0-9a-zA-Z])*@0-9a-zA-Z*\.[a-zA-Z]{2,4}$',$email)==false ? false : true);
}
Viele Grüße
0-9a-zA-Z ↩︎